Transaction 8b09062fd2fcf5708255c526023e8a31a1a8bc42575fdcd9895199152093390b
1 Input
1 Output
-
8b09062fd2fcf5708255c526023e8a31a1a8bc42575fdcd9895199152093390b:0
- value
- 156594
- script pubkey
- OP_0 OP_PUSHBYTES_20 88c47867c44338bdf4d25c6b63c3823567ce9928
- address
- bc1q3rz8se7ygvutmaxjt34k8suzx4nuaxfgc627hp